В ноябре 2024 выпуска не будет, KB5046687 ломает браузеры.
UpdatePack7R2 для обновления Windows 7 SP1 и Server 2008 R2 SP1
Набор позволяет обновлять рабочую систему, а также интегрировать обновления в дистрибутив. Может быть установлен на любую редакцию Windows 7 и Server 2008 R2, любого языка и архитектуры. Включены обновления для Internet Explorer 11, все критические, рекомендуемые и обновления безопасности. Смотрите подробности в списке обновлений.
Использование
В системе должно быть не меньше 10 ГБ свободного места на винчестере и желательно не меньше 1 ГБ свободной оперативной памяти.
Можно перетянуть мышкой чистый iso-дистрибутив на UpdatePack7R2 и получить готовый обновлённый iso-образ.
Для гибкой установки набора можно использовать следующие ключи и их комбинации:
-
- Ключ /Reboot для автоматической перезагрузки, если она потребуется.
- Ключ /S для полностью тихой установки без окон и сообщений. Регистр имеет значение.
- Ключ /Silent для пассивной установки — видно прогресс, но установка полностью автоматическая.
- Ключ /Temp= позволяет задать временный рабочий каталог. Он не обязан быть пустым, но должен существовать.
- Ключ /NoSpace позволяет пропустить проверку свободного места на системном разделе, использовать не рекомендуется.
- Ключ /FixOn включает защиту от Meltdown и Spectre, а /FixOff её выключает. Без ключей для Win7 защита выключена, а для Win2008R2 включена.
Примеры:
-
- Нужно автоматически установить все обновления, IE11 и перезагрузить компьютер: UpdatePack7R2.exe /silent /reboot
- Нужно скрыто установить все обновления к имеющимся продуктам и компьютер не перезагружать: UpdatePack7R2.exe /S
Следующие ключи предназначены для интеграции обновлений в дистрибутив:
-
- Ключ /WimFile= указывает расположение wim-файла, необходимо задавать абсолютный путь.
- Ключ /Index= указывает индекс системы в wim-файле, для каждого индекса необходимо выполнять интеграцию заново.
- Ключ /Index=* позволяет выполнить поочерёдную интеграцию обновлений во все индексы wim-файла.
- Ключ /Boot= указывает расположение boot.wim для интеграции поддержки NVMe и USB3.
- Ключ /Optimize разрешает оптимизировать размер wim-файла после интеграции обновлений.
- Ключ /Optimize=esd преобразует wim-файл в esd после интеграции обновлений.
- Ключ /NoUSB отменяет интеграцию универсального драйвера USB3 от daniel_k.
Примечания:
-
- Перед указанием индекса полезно выполнить команду: Dism /Get-WimInfo /WimFile:C:\install.wim (путь замените на свой).
- При обновлении boot.wim необходимо скопировать новые файлы из папки sources в дистрибутив согласно инструкции.
Примеры:
-
- Нужно интегрировать IE11 и все обновления в 1 индекс: UpdatePack7R2.exe /WimFile=C:\install.wim /Index=1
- Нужно интегрировать IE11 и все обновления во все индексы: UpdatePack7R2.exe /WimFile=C:\install.wim /Index=*
Дополнительный функционал
-
- Возможна автоматическая установка SP1, если он не установлен в системе. Для этого нужно расположить файлы Windows6.1-KB976932-X86.exe и Windows6.1-KB976932-X64.exe в одном каталоге с набором.
- Если рядом с набором есть UpdatePack7R2Start.cmd — он будет выполнен перед установкой обновлений, UpdatePack7R2Finish.cmd — после установки, UpdatePack7R2Wim.cmd — после интеграции обновлений. По умолчанию консольные окна будут показаны. Чтобы их скрыть, первая строка в cmd-файле должна начинаться с «:hide» (без кавычек). Набор обновлений отслеживает код выхода из cmd-файлов, на случай необходимости перезагрузки. Этот код равен 3010 (команда exit 3010).
- Если вы хотите применить свои твики после установки Internet Explorer 11 на рабочую систему, расположите в папке с набором файл ie11.reg и он будет импортирован автоматически.
- Некоторые ключи можно заменить переименованием самого файла набора. Так для автоматический перезагрузки можно добавить слово «−−» в любое место имени файла набора и «++» для пассивной установки.
- Поддерживается установка и интеграция аддонов: SmartFix, DirectX, .NET Framework, Visual C++. Файлы аддонов нужно расположить в одной папке с UpdatePack7R2.
Примеры:
-
- Нужно автоматически установить набор на рабочую систему вместе с IE11 и перезагрузить компьютер: переименуйте UpdatePack7R2.exe в UpdatePack7R2−−++.exe
- Это будет абсолютно аналогично использованию следующих ключей: UpdatePack7R2.exe /silent /reboot
Примечания
-
- Размер дистрибутива (wim-файл) будет увеличен на размер установленных обновлений.
- Интегрированные обновления можно будет удалить даже после установки системы.
- Рекомендуется выгружать из памяти резидентный антивирусный монитор на время работы набора.
- Подробный журнал установки обновлений находится в файле %WinDir%\UpdatePack7.log.
- Установка на рабочую систему будет произведена в несколько этапов с перезагрузками.
Интегрировал обновления UpdatePack7R2 20.5.20 с аддоном NET Framework в образ Windows 7 SP1 Ultimate. После этого установил систему.
При работе заметил ошибку, которая многократно появляется при установке некоторых программ.
Скриншот: https://i.gyazo.com/52c8d1b779bfdb9c9d8f485b078171ce.png
В момент ошибки установка программ приостанавливается, когда ошибку закрываешь, установка продолжается, но в процессе установки эта ошибка может появляться десятки раз и её нужно постоянно закрывать. С чем это может быть связано? Замечена ли эта ошибка и может быть уже исправлена в новых сборках?
Эта проблема исправлена в новых наборах.
Понял.
Установил UpdatePack7R2 20.6.11 — проблема исчезла.
Спасибо.
simplix, имеется ли в ваших наборах какой-то идентификатор, по которому можно определить, что обновления установлены именно вашим набором?
Он обнаружится после прочтения шапки.
Нашёл.
%WinDir%\UpdatePack7.log
Надеюсь это единственный идентификатор.
Извиняюсь за спам.
Спасибо.
Можно ли скачивать только обновления, вышедшие после последнего набора? Каждый раз качать полные наборы — проблема.
На сайте Microsoft каждое обновление обновление можно загрузить отдельно.
Действительно)
В версии 20.7.15 «Добавлена интеграция универсального драйвера USB3 от daniel_k»
При интеграции в установочный образ этот драйвер автоматически интегрируется, или нужно дополнительно ключ какой-то добавить? И можно ли не интегрировать этот драйвер?
Хватит спамить, ответы на ваши вопросы есть на этой же странице.
Здравствуйте уважаемые. А как поставить обновление KB4566517 а то никак не удаётся.
Номер ошибки: Code 643
Можно установить с помощью соответствующего аддона, информация в шапке.
Спасибо simplix Всё поставилось на ОК
Извините за вопрос. В boot.wim каких версий Windows (7, 10) можно интегрировать универсаььные драйверы USB 3,0??
Только в Win7, дальше поддержка USB3 уже есть.
UpdatePack7R2.exe Boot=C:\ /ie11 /WimFile=C:\install.wim /Index=* /Optimize
Подскажите, пожалуйста. При введении такой команды Подключение и отключение образа boot.wim подключается и отключается только один раз или при интеграции обновлений в каждый образ?
Ключ указан неправильно и путь должен быть абсолютным. Что мешает вам узнать ответ на свой вопрос самостоятельно на практике?
Здравствуйте, Помогите пожалуйста с Security and Quality Rollup for.NET Framework (KB4566517), для него нужен отдельный ключ тогда, где его взять? или подойдёт отсюда? https://blog.simplix.info/updatepack7r2/comment-page-37/#comment-1809 И какую версию KBxxxxxxx NET Framework 4.8 скачать надо?
Ключ не работает с новым обновлением, проще и быстрее установить его с помощью аддона, информация в шапке.
Спасибо NET Framework 4.8 встал, как родной. Ставил по этой инструкции https://forum.simplix.info/viewtopic.php?id=718
Можете посмотреть на форуме. На моей семёрке успешно установилось.
https://forum.simplix.info/viewtopic.php?id=718
Ноут Lenovo, i5, Win7Ultimate-x64, обновление 20.7.15 было запущено с ключами UpdatePack7R2.exe /ie11 /silent /reboot /temp=D:/2222/
Пишет:
— Распаковка обновлений…
— Обновление системы, не отключайте…
— 99% … Обновление не удалось, отмена изменений…
И так по кругу в бесконечном цикле. Как относительно корректно прервать этот бесконечный цикл?
Где искать лог?
Где искать лог написано в шапке, а если вам нужно решить проблему, тогда нужно её воспроизвести.
В логе указывается:
—
Журнал установки UpdatePack 7 / 2008 R2 / 20.7.15
Время начала установки — 18:46:34 17.07.2020
Операционная система — Windows 7 Ultimate SP1 x64
KB4474419-v3 — Для завершения установки требуется перезагрузка
KB3125574-v4 — Для завершения установки требуется перезагрузка
Время окончания установки — 18:56:30 17.07.2020
Количество установленных обновлений — 2
Общее время установки набора — 09:56
Работа программы успешно завершена
—
Потом система перзагружается, идёт установка обновлений, доходит до 99%, «Не удалось установить, откат» и так по кругу без конца (обратите на общее время 09:56)
Как отменить работу UpdatePack7R2, чтобы можно было нормально загрузиться?
(на счёт создания образа я подумаю, сейчас нет возможности)
Просто нажимаете кнопку «Отмена» во время распаковки обновлений. Кроме того в наборе есть защита от цикличных установок, даже если вы ничего не будете нажимать, через несколько попыток установки набор прекратит работу.